对象存储服务器有哪几种方式,深入解析,对象存储服务器的多种类型及其应用场景
- 综合资讯
- 2024-12-20 07:22:59
- 2

对象存储服务器主要有文件系统、分布式文件系统、块存储和对象存储四种类型。文件系统适合存储小文件,分布式文件系统适合大规模存储,块存储适合需要快速读写操作的场景,而对象存...
对象存储服务器主要有文件系统、分布式文件系统、块存储和对象存储四种类型。文件系统适合存储小文件,分布式文件系统适合大规模存储,块存储适合需要快速读写操作的场景,而对象存储适用于海量非结构化数据的存储。不同类型的应用场景包括:文件系统用于个人或小组的文件存储,分布式文件系统用于大规模数据存储,块存储用于数据库和虚拟机,对象存储用于云存储和大数据处理。
随着互联网的快速发展,数据量呈爆炸式增长,传统的存储方式已经无法满足日益增长的数据存储需求,对象存储服务器作为一种新兴的存储技术,因其高扩展性、高可靠性、低成本等特点,逐渐成为企业数据存储的首选,本文将深入解析对象存储服务器的多种类型及其应用场景,帮助读者全面了解这一技术。
对象存储服务器概述
对象存储服务器(Object Storage Server)是一种基于对象模型的存储系统,它将数据存储为对象,每个对象包含数据本身、元数据以及唯一标识符,与传统的文件存储和块存储相比,对象存储服务器具有以下特点:
1、数据存储粒度小:对象存储服务器将数据存储为单个对象,每个对象可以包含任意大小的数据,从而实现细粒度的数据管理。
2、高扩展性:对象存储服务器采用分布式架构,可以通过增加节点来扩展存储容量,满足大规模数据存储需求。
3、高可靠性:对象存储服务器采用数据冗余、数据复制等技术,确保数据的安全性和可靠性。
4、低成本:对象存储服务器采用通用硬件,降低了存储成本。
对象存储服务器的类型
1、分布式对象存储服务器
分布式对象存储服务器采用分布式架构,将数据分散存储在多个节点上,通过数据复制和冗余技术保证数据的安全性和可靠性,常见的分布式对象存储服务器有:
(1)Ceph:Ceph是一种开源的分布式存储系统,具有高可靠性、高可用性和高扩展性等特点。
(2)GlusterFS:GlusterFS是一种开源的分布式文件系统,支持多种存储协议,如NFS、SMB等。
(3)HDFS:HDFS是Hadoop分布式文件系统,主要用于存储大规模数据。
2、集中式对象存储服务器
集中式对象存储服务器采用单节点或多节点集群架构,将数据集中存储在服务器上,常见的集中式对象存储服务器有:
(1)OpenStack Swift:OpenStack Swift是一种开源的对象存储系统,具有高可用性、高扩展性和高可靠性等特点。
(2)Amazon S3:Amazon S3是亚马逊云服务提供的对象存储服务,具有高可靠性、高可用性和高扩展性等特点。
(3)阿里云OSS:阿里云OSS是阿里云提供的一种对象存储服务,具有高可靠性、高可用性和高扩展性等特点。
3、软件定义对象存储服务器
软件定义对象存储服务器是一种基于通用硬件和虚拟化技术的对象存储解决方案,常见的软件定义对象存储服务器有:
(1)Ceph:Ceph不仅可以作为分布式对象存储服务器,还可以作为软件定义对象存储服务器。
(2)Red Hat Ceph Storage:Red Hat Ceph Storage是基于Ceph的软件定义对象存储解决方案。
对象存储服务器的应用场景
1、大数据存储
对象存储服务器具有高扩展性和高可靠性,适用于大数据存储场景,如日志存储、视频存储、图片存储等。
2、云计算平台
对象存储服务器可以作为云计算平台的数据存储后端,为虚拟机、容器等提供数据存储服务。
3、文件共享与协作
对象存储服务器可以提供文件共享和协作功能,如团队文件存储、个人文件存储等。
4、数据备份与归档
对象存储服务器具有低成本、高可靠性等特点,适用于数据备份和归档场景。
5、物联网
对象存储服务器可以存储物联网设备产生的海量数据,如传感器数据、设备日志等。
对象存储服务器作为一种新兴的存储技术,具有高扩展性、高可靠性、低成本等特点,广泛应用于大数据、云计算、文件共享、数据备份等领域,本文对对象存储服务器的类型进行了深入解析,并介绍了其应用场景,希望对读者有所帮助,随着技术的不断发展,对象存储服务器将在更多领域发挥重要作用。
本文链接:https://www.zhitaoyun.cn/1677864.html
发表评论